“Martha’s attitude toward slavery reflected the attitude of other women of her social class in Virginia at the time. She had an unquestioned belief in white superiority. Although utterly dependent on slave labor for her daily existence, she suspected her slaves’ honesty and work ethic. Although she had close personal relationships with certain individual slaves, she considered slaves as a group to be like children, or lazy, ungovernable wretches. Unlike her husband, Martha never came to doubt the morality or justice of the institution which made her life as a plantation mistress possible.”

Martha and women at camp

Every winter Martha would make the journey to camp

Seen as a good sign by soldiers, done with fighting for year

Confidant, secretary, representative, comfort to sick, moral boost to entire camp

Hostess to visiting dignitaries, leaders, congressmen
